Realities of Contemporary Nursing sharpens decision-making and problem-solving skills with class-tested critical thinking questions and includes a new chapter that provides an overview of critical thinking concepts; discusses the need for cultural competence and caring in today's diverse society and provides for a greater understanding of the real world of nursing; reveals the impact of power, politics, ethics, and collective bargaining in the workplace; describes situations commonly faced by practicing nurses in real-life vignettes; examines techniques for identifying and managing job-related stress and conflict; provides learning objectives, learning activities, and chapter summaries to assist students in incorporating vital information into their professional lives; and allows students to increase their knowledge of current nursing issues with the use of an annotated bibliography of relevant readings.
